Location and Accessibility
Core Creek Landing is situated at 8100 NC-55, Dover, NC 28526, USA. This location places it in the eastern part of North Carolina, within Craven County. It's nestled in the state's coastal plain region, offering a different landscape experience compared to the bustling mountains or city-adjacent campgrounds. The "Landing" in its name suggests direct access to Core Creek, a tributary that flows into the larger Neuse River system, providing opportunities for water-based activities like fishing, kayaking, or simply enjoying the peaceful waterfront.
For North Carolina residents, the accessibility of Core Creek Landing is quite favorable, especially for those in the central and eastern parts of the state. Dover is a small, quiet town, which contributes to the tranquil atmosphere of the campground. It's located off NC-55, a state highway that connects to larger routes, making it straightforward to navigate to from nearby cities. For example, it's roughly an hour's drive from Greenville, about 20-30 minutes from New Bern, and within a couple of hours' drive from Raleigh, providing a convenient weekend escape for a significant portion of the state's population. The roads leading to the campground are generally well-maintained, accommodating both RVs and vehicles towing campers. Its relative seclusion ensures a genuine sense of getting away from it all, without being overly difficult to reach, making it an ideal choice for North Carolinians looking for an accessible yet peaceful retreat. Core Creek Landing Reviews
This place was great! They have very clean working toilets, a sink outside of the toilets, and a nice hot shower to wash off the camp fire smell before you head out! The owners were very nice and told us we could just find a spot, so we picked the far back spot by the water. They have piles of fire wood for you to use or you can use down branches. The weekend we went out we were told it was pretty busy but usually its quiet. (Still wasn't an issue). There is plenty of room for RV's or tent camping. You don't have to pay but they do except donations. Thanks again for sharing your awesome slice of land! I can't wait to come back.
Nov 08, 2020 · illuminotmeGreat peaceful place, only one bad point. No hot water in showers.but other then that everything's is fantastic. All dogs🦮🐕🐕🦺🐩 welcome!
Mar 27, 2023 · Barbara SmithGreat place to tent camp relax and fish will be going back
Jul 14, 2024 · John RidgellUsually not crowded. Privately owned. Quiet, no electricity and please DON'T bring a generator. Primitive camping. Love this place !
